When an ad set spends more than $100 in the last 3 days including today and it has a great ROAS this rule would remove ONE_HUNDRED$ from its name and add TWO_HUNDRED$ instead. The use of the name contains/doesn't contain filter is absolutely nessesary so that you don't keep adding something to the names, making them 400 charaters long. Watch the video for more details ;)
